Now Wisteria Wonder is not a colour I would turn to normally but I liked the overall effect here, contrasted against that real pop of Whisper White of the topper and the accent bits of inking in Elegant Eggplant and toning sponging on the butterfly,  in Perfect Plum.

...and with the tactile feel of the 'Thanks' from the Expressions Natural Elements pack - (I suggest you grab these while you can as they are being retired as we speak!)
and the little bit of Gold Metallic thread peeping behind the butterfly,  all set off with my customary bits of bling - well I think it came together as I wanted, by the time I had finished.

Now, not sure about anyone else - but  I do buy lots of the gorgeous packs of Designer series papers but then find it really difficult to actually cut into the sheets but needs must and I really thought it was about time I set about trying to reduce my very own paper mountain -  well I have to make room for some new packs now, don't I!

so the paper you can see is an attempt at using  up some of my last year's scraps!! of  retired papers for accents and a  mini-treat bag which I used for an envelope, but of course any paper which tones in in with your project would do equally as well.
  • Tip here .. Stampin' Up!'s Note cards (you get 20 in a pack, and the card themselves fit perfectly in one of those Mini-Treat bags if you wanted a change from the standard envelopes you get in the pack!)
